It's more than just a film in my opinion, it's a life experience! 1 Replies | Report Abuse Thanks! 0 Replies | Report Abuse MM, I first saw "2001: A Space Odyssey" when it was released in 1968 in Cinerama. That means it was filmed in sections on three cameras and projected simultaneously to three large screens set in a curved semicircle. Special theaters were created for this format, but alas Cinerama was too expensive and it did not last. You can imagine the impression this film made on me as a young man... the images wrapped around the audience. It seemed almost as if we were in deep space. 2 Replies | Report Abuse Still my favorite Kubrick film, and I'm amazed how it has held up through the years.
